Mairi Stewart's passion for animals has led to a career in animal welfare research with AgResearch.
Mairi is now completing a PhD with Massey University and AgResearch which involves developing a non-invasive method for measuring stress in farm animals. Using an infrared thermographic camera she records an image of the heat being emitted by the animal…high temperatures mean high stress.
"At AgResearch I get to undertake research that contributes to my PhD studies and in the long term I hope my research will improve animal welfare on farms…. that's what really drives me".
